Abstract
The embodiment of the invention discloses a kind of monitoring method of storage cluster system and device.Wherein, method includes being based on snmp agreements, obtains the running state information of each storage device in distributed storage group system;Keyword in running state information, is parsed to running state information, obtains the monitoring report of distributed storage group system;By monitoring report by web page, it is shown to user.By the running state information for catching simultaneously each storage device of analysis distribution formula group system, realize the outer batch monitoring of band of storage cluster multiple storage devices, these status informations are showed into user in the form of web page, so as to user, such as computer room administrator, more intuitively, the running status of currently stored cluster is easily understood, be advantageous to the failure that user has found storage cluster in time, and fault location, so as to rapidly removing faults, be advantageous to improve the reliability and stability of storage cluster system.

Snmp protocol (Simple Network Management Protocol, Simple Network Management Protocol), it is by one
The standard composition of group network management, includes an application layer protocol (application layer protocol), database mould
Type (database schema) and one group of resource object.The agreement can support NMS, and net is connected to monitor
Whether the equipment on network has any situation for causing and being paid close attention in management.The network of snmp management by be managed equipment, SNMP generations
Reason and NMS (NMS) are formed.Managed devices, also known as NE or network node, can support SNMP
Router, interchanger, server or main frame of agreement etc..SNMP agent is that a network management on managed devices is soft
Part module, possess the related administrative information of local device, and for being converted into the form compatible with SNMP, pass to
NMS.By snmp protocol, NMS can obtain these information, and operation application program monitors the function of managed devices to realize.Separately
Outside, NMS also provides substantial amounts of processing routine and necessary storage resources for network management.
Storage application service is established based on snmp agreements, in Network Environment of Computer Laboratory, by monitoring system and storage cluster system
The vertical docking of construction in a systematic way is serviced, and the storage management IP of storage cluster is added to snmp management cluster, by analyzing storage device
Running state information keyword, it may be determined that storage device corresponding to running state information, that is, realize the positioning of hardware device.
The running state information of storage device is the controller of storage device, power supply, hard disk, BBU PSU, UPS, sensing
The running status of the devices such as device, FAN, running state information may include the warning message of storage device, may also include the extensive of storage
Complex information, such as " ALERT:Controller BBU Absent or Failed!" and " NOTICE:Controller BBU
Present”.There is damage (failure) or during abnormal signals in these devices, can export corresponding warning message, so that the external world can be with
The position for judging to go wrong by relevant information.
It can be monitoring server to perform subject, and as distributed storage cluster establishes monitoring system, and monitoring system may include
Massaging device, monitoring server, snmp data transmission devices and exhibiting device are gathered, wherein, collection massaging device takes with monitoring
Business device can establish C/S mode of operations, and monitoring server establishes B/S mode of operations by providing WEB access interfaces with demonstration device.
User carries out checking monitoring information by the WEB page of demonstration device.The running state information that collection massaging device will collect
Sent by snmp data transmission devices to monitoring server, constantly receive monitoring server and the information being resolved to is sent to exhibition
Showing device.
Exhibiting device can monitor in real time in (such as 30min) automatic refresh page, realization at regular intervals, also can be real-time
Refresh page, but too big change will not occur in a short time for running status, carry out refreshing in real time and be not necessarily to, and can increase
Big later data treating capacity, take the resource of system;Therefore optionally, it can be refreshed within the default time.Accordingly, supervise
Distributed storage can be obtained according to default frequency (i.e. predetermined period, a such as data of acquisition are carried out per 30s) by controlling server
The running state information of each storage device in group system.
Monitoring server can be carried out when being parsed to running state information by parsing the keyword in running status
Parsing, obtains monitoring report, and user can get information about the running status of storage device in storage cluster by monitoring report,
For example whether break down.Such as when the keyword included in the running state information received is " ALERT:Controller
BBU Absent or Failed!", the monitoring report of generation can be " Battery Backup Unit (BBU) is
missing”;When the keyword included in the running state information received is " NOTICE:Controller BBU
Present!", the monitoring report of generation can be " Controller battery backup unit (BBU) back to
normal”。
Monitoring server uses B/S structures with exhibiting device, can be based on J2EE and develop.Exhibiting device mainly realizes storage prison
The constantly circular of control information shows, and can realize the functions such as the inquiry of historical data, storage information management, with javascript technologies
To realize the integrated of above- mentioned information, being shown without refreshing for the page can be realized using Ajax technologies.At application server end, can adopt
By the use of Tomcat as distribution platform, for the explanation of JSP and the issue of WEB catalogues.In the database server side of bottom,
Compatibility and stability in view of database to operating system, oracle can be used as database server.
